当前位置: 首页> 标题公式> 正文

如何设置标题动画效果

宁旺春土特产品

在当今数字化的时代,无论是网页设计、演示文稿制作还是创作,标题动画效果都能起到吸引观众注意力、增强内容表现力的重要作用。一个富有创意和动态感的标题动画,能够瞬间抓住用户的眼球,让信息更加生动形象地传达出来。那么,该如何设置标题动画效果呢?下面就为大家详细介绍不同场景下的设置方法。

如何设置标题动画效果

在网页设计中,CSS3和JavaScript是实现标题动画效果的常用工具。CSS3提供了丰富的动画属性,如`animation`和`transition`,可以创建各种简单而又炫酷的动画。例如,要实现标题的淡入效果,可以先在CSS中定义一个关键帧动画。

```css

@keyframes fadeIn {

from {

opacity: 0;

}

to {

opacity: 1;

}

}

h1 {

animation: fadeIn 2s ease-in-out;

}

```

在这段代码中,`@keyframes`定义了一个名为`fadeIn`的动画,从透明度为0逐渐变为1。然后将这个动画应用到`h1`标题元素上,持续时间为2秒,动画过渡效果为`ease-in-out`,使得标题看起来更加自然。

如果想要实现更复杂的动画,如标题的旋转、缩放等效果,可以结合多个属性。例如:

```css

@keyframes rotateAndScale {

0% {

transform: rotate(0deg) scale(0.5);

}

100% {

transform: rotate(360deg) scale(1);

}

}

h1 {

animation: rotateAndScale 3s infinite;

}

```

这里定义了一个`rotateAndScale`动画,标题会在3秒内从旋转0度且缩放为0.5逐渐变为旋转360度且缩放为1,并且无限循环播放。

而JavaScript可以与CSS结合,实现更具交互性的标题动画。比如,当用户滚动页面到标题位置时触发动画。可以使用`IntersectionObserver` API来检测元素是否进入视口。

```javascript

const title = document.querySelector('h1');

const observer = new IntersectionObserver((entries) => {

entries.forEach((entry) => {

if (entry.isIntersecting) {

title.classList.add('animate');

}

});

});

observer.observe(title);

```

在CSS中为`.animate`类添加相应的动画效果,当标题进入视口时,就会触发动画。

在演示文稿软件如Microsoft PowerPoint中,设置标题动画效果相对简单。首先选中要添加动画的标题,然后在“动画”选项卡中选择合适的动画效果,如“飞入”“缩放”“旋转”等。还可以调整动画的开始时间、持续时间和延迟时间。例如,设置标题在幻灯片出现后1秒开始动画,持续2秒。PowerPoint还提供了动画路径功能,可以让标题沿着自定义的路径移动,增加动画的趣味性。

在制作中,像Adobe Premiere Pro和Final Cut Pro等软件都能轻松实现标题动画效果。以Adobe Premiere Pro为例,在“字幕”面板中创建标题后,将其拖到时间轴上。然后在“效果控件”面板中可以对标题的位置、大小、透明度等属性进行关键帧动画设置。比如,在时间轴的起始位置设置标题的透明度为0,然后在几秒后设置透明度为100,这样就实现了标题的淡入效果。还可以通过添加预设的动画效果,如“滚动”“闪烁”等,快速为标题增添活力。

设置标题动画效果的方法多种多样,要根据具体的应用场景和需求选择合适的工具和方法。无论是简单的淡入淡出,还是复杂的动态交互,都能通过合理运用相应的技术和软件来实现,从而让标题在各种平台上都能大放异彩。

PC右下角
wap底部